Maryam Laushi, born in 1996 in Kaduna State, Nigeria, has emerged as a significant communication specialist and activist. She’s recognized for her advocacy in gender equality and youth inclusion in Nigerian politics.

Education

Maryam received her early education in Kaduna State. She furthered her studies at Coventry University, UK, earning a Bachelor’s degree in Advertising and Media, and a Master’s degree in Marketing Management.

Career

Maryam Laushi began her career as a research and social media assistant for Mallam Nasir El Rufai’s gubernatorial campaign in 2015. She later joined Leadership Newspaper groups in Abuja as a news media manager. Laushi has played a pivotal role in the ‘Not Too Young To Run Leadership Team’ and has been recognized with awards for her active citizenry and contributions to politics and governance.

Personal Life

Maryam Laushi is married to Leo Da Silva. She has consistently advocated for women’s rights and youth involvement in politics, which reflects her commitment to social change in Nigeria.
